What You’ll Do

We’re seeking a highly organized, analytical, and detail-oriented Senior Credit Card Operations Manager to oversee and optimize the performance, compliance, and daily operations of our credit card program. You will work cross-functionally with internal stakeholders and external partners (e.g., issuing banks, processors, and networks) to ensure smooth execution of our card initiatives, manage key vendor relationships, and help scale the program as we grow.

Responsibilities

  • Lead day-to-day operations of our crypto-backed credit card
  • Manage relationships with issuing banks, processors, and card networks 
  • Monitor program KPIs like authorization rates, chargeback trends, fraud alerts, rewards redemptions, and and provide actionable recommendations
  • Partner with Risk, Compliance, Finance, Engineering, and Product teams to support both day-to-day execution and long-term program strategy
  • Oversee settlement, reconciliation, and reporting between fiat and crypto flows
  • Coordinate incident responses, escalations, and resolutions related to card operations
  • Develop and document operational processes, playbooks, and SLAs - help design scalable operational processes as we launch in new markets or add new card products
  • Serve as the go-to expert internally for all things related to card program operations
  • Marketing - collateral management and events activation oversight 

What we're looking for

  • 4+ years of experience in card operations, fintech, or crypto financial services
  • Deep understanding of card issuing flows — including transaction processing, disputes/chargebacks, BIN sponsorship, fraud tooling, and network compliance
  • Working knowledge of regulatory and compliance standards (e.g., Reg E, UDAAP, PCI-DSS)
  • Strong project management skills with a bias toward execution
  • Familiarity with crypto concepts (custody, stablecoins, wallets, off-ramps) and a passion for Web3
  • Proven ability to manage external partners and internal stakeholders across compliance, engineering, finance, and customer support
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Highly organized, detail-oriented, and proactive
  • Bonus: You’ve helped launch or scale a card product at a fintech or crypto startup

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
